Bureau of Indian Standards signs MoU with partner institutions: 500 internships for students

The Bureau of Indian Standards (BIS) has announced internship opportunities for 500 students from its partner institutions in the field of standardisation.

Hyderabad: The Bureau of Indian Standards (BIS) has announced internship opportunities for 500 students from its partner institutions in the field of standardisation.

The internships will be offered to students enrolled in 4-year degree courses, 5-year integrated degree courses, postgraduate degrees, and diploma programmes. The 8-week internship will include pre-standardisation work in two key industries, QCO (Quality Control Order) compliance surveys in collaboration with BIS offices, and site visits to large-scale units, MSMEs and laboratories.


Students will undertake detailed studies on manufacturing and testing processes, raw materials, in-process controls, and other aspects of product quality and conformity assessment.

Standardisation modules have been incorporated into the curriculum of 15 institutes and more than 130 research and development projects have been commissioned. Over 50 institutions have established BIS Corners and Academic Dashboards and a total of 198 Standards Clubs have been formed across 52 institutes.
